3v with a low temperature temper is actually quite stain resistant, but I don’t think they use a low temp temper. Even with a high temp temper it still has some bit of stain resistance tho and isn’t fast to rust but will oxidize and surface pit on you if not cared for properly. Easy to wipe that right off tho. Magnacut actually has a really low chromium content for a stainless but is still insanely stain resistant. 3v is 7.5% chromium while magnacut is like 10.5%. Magnacut uses some steel chemistry magic to make the chromium all or mostly free and available at the surface level and throughout, so it has insane corrosion resistance. Amazing stuff, really.
